Explanation

Port scanning is a core reconnaissance and penetration testing technique used to discover open ports and running services on a target system. By identifying which ports are open, testers can map the attack surface and find exploitable services that may allow access to unauthorized information. The other options are unrelated to this objective: Van Eck Phreaking involves capturing electromagnetic emissions from monitors to reconstruct displayed content, Phreaking refers to exploiting telephone/PSTN systems, and a Biometrician is a professional who works with biometric identification systems rather than a hacking technique.
